Nothing will stop me from being the next President, says Ruto

Deputy President William Ruto has told off his critics saying nothing will stop him from being the President come 2022.

Speaking on Saturday during his Meru tour accompanied by more than 15 Members of Parliament allied to the Hustlers team, DP Ruto warned his opponents to prepare for a early defeat in the next polls.

The Deputy President and his allies accused the Orange Democratic Movement (ODM) leader Raila Odinga of "selfish and greed by hiding behind the Handshake and Building Bridges Initiative (BBI)to gain power through backdoor".

The DP while addressing residents in Maua town and Tigania West further accused a section of political lords of deploying intimidation mechanisms to block him from advancing his Hustlers agenda.

"This time, we are giving them a early notice that we are not afraid of deep state and systems because we are the system ourselves. I wonder which system my friend Raila is talking about when he never formed any government. If he thinks he will gain power through 'system' we are telling him to forget because Kenyans are not foolish since we struggled to form this government,"said Ruto.

He at the same said it was unfortunate that the BBI has misplaced the priorities of Big Four Agenda which is aimed at creating jobs and narrow the gap between the poor and the rich .

"The Jubilee government should focus on the Big Four Agenda which is out to create 4 million jobs and not BBI which only concentrate on creating only three jobs for people already with jobs," added Ruto

"I am the Deputy President of Kenya and we are the government ourselves...let them bring it over. We will crush it. Nobody can force us to talk about power sharing and tribalism through the BBI when the common man is suffering and continue to languish in poverty," added Ruto.

While wooing the region to back his Presidency bid in 2022, Ruto said Kenya needs a visionary leader who is ready to address social -economical problems affecting the common man from the grassroot .

"No amount of force will derail me from working for Kenyans and helping the common man who is suffering in the village. This is the Hustlers Nation main agenda. We are telling those trying to gain power through the backdoor to forget. I am not afraid of being victimized. Let them stop and block my meetings but they will not stop Kenyans from voting for me as the next President," he added.

Accompanied by Senator Mithika Linturi ( Meru) MPs Didmus Baraza(Kimilili),Nimrod Mbai (Kitui East), Aisha Jumwa (Malindi), Moses Kuria (Gatundu South),Kimani Ichungwa (Kikuyu),Rigathi Gachagua (Mathira),Cecily Mbarire (nominated), Rahim Dawood( Imenti North) Mugambi Rindikiri (Buuri), John Paul Mwirigi (Igembe South),Josphat Kabeabea (Tigania East). Also present were Women Reps Rehema Jaldesa (Isiolo) and her Tharaka Nithi counterpart Beatrice Nkatha.

The TangaTanga allies at the same urged the locals to reject the BBI initiative saying it only out to advance the political agenda of the few individuals .

"We beg you not to make a mistake to support BBI because it just a document to for power sharing but not to advance the interest of common man," added Mrs Jumwa.

Linturi and Kuria assured locals that Mt.Kenya will back the DP Presidential bid and overwhelmingly vote for him in the 2022 General Election.

"Those who are saying Mt.Kenya East is not behind Ruto are misleading. We are are not ready to be pushed on which direction to take politically and we are sure President Uhuru Kenyatta will not endorse Raila who is older than him," added Kuria
